Output d646ba7124e98a0aad484e5131e4c92aa31b8d00d7334c0613123a04b709cb53:16

value
625226
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ba2b8ef139b3b70220e7f1c7258aafce2e37918d OP_EQUALVERIFY OP_CHECKSIG
address
1HyNsAoLPK3FZ5CNfyZt6dKrpfwBdk8mqT
transaction
d646ba7124e98a0aad484e5131e4c92aa31b8d00d7334c0613123a04b709cb53
confirmations
419918
spent
true